I have some Gerber ones which have the paddded cloth panel and also some "cloth diaper" type trainers (one by Bumpy and one by Mother of Eden). In my experience, none of them hold much pee. If its a trickle, I guess it would be OK, but for a true "accident", they are worthless, IMO. In the early days of training, when we were having lots of accidents at home, her urine just streamed through all types of cloth trainers just like plain underwear.
We just wear underwear everywhere. What I do for longer trips is I use a small cloth prefold diaper with a lap pad under her in the carseat. That way if she does have an accident, the carseat is protected. The prefolds are very inexpensive ($1 - $2 each) and the lap pads are ones I got when she was younger, the small ones that are 2 or 3 for $5 at BRU and places like that.
